The Department of Technical Education, Andhra Pradesh, will today start the online counselling process for admission to polytechnic courses in engineering and non-engineering institutes of the state. All candidates, regardless of rank, can pay the AP POLYCET 2025 processing fee online between June 20 and June 27. The fee is Rs 700 for OC and BC candidates and it is Rs 250 for SC and ST candidates. Complete information regarding eligibility, counselling, documents required and the official brochure is available on the AP POLYCET website – polycet.ap.gov.in.
Candidates who have qualified in the AP POLYCET exam held on April 30 can register for the
online web-based counselling and offline document verification process. The department has set different dates for the document verification process as per ranks of the candidates.
The Andhra Pradesh Polytechnic Common Entrance Test (AP POLYCET), held by the Department of Technical Education, Andhra Pradesh, is an entrance exam for admission into diploma programmes in engineering, non-engineering, and technology. These programmes are offered by both government-aided and private polytechnic institutions, including those operating as second-shift colleges within private engineering institutions across the state. The exam is conducted in offline mode.
